NextComputing introduces Vigor Evo HD
Posted on Apr 21, 08 09:42 AM PDT

The Vigor Evo HD from NextComputing has been specially optimized to provide advanced computing power in rugged environments such as military field operations or oil and gas research sites.
The Vigor Evo HD is a "flextop," a high-performance mobile system incorporating the company's privately designed FleXtreme architecture. This architecture features open standards components, support for COTS software and hardware, best-in-breed multi-core processors, high-capacity storage, support for multiple operating systems, and multiple I/O functionality including PCI Express x16 slots. The Vigor Evo HD is a ruggedized version of NextComputing's most powerful "flextop," the NextDimension Evo HD. Both systems are designed for applications requiring the features of the most powerful desktop workstation in a portable form factor.
The chassis itself boasts an integrated 17" LCD covered by a disposable protective screen, featuring anti-glare, hardening, and optical enhancement coatings. Sounds as though this bad boy is more than capable of taking a beating even at the rowdiest of LAN parties.
